(c) Under Section XXXI., some authorities as to the requirements of specifications filed by creditors who oppose the granting of the discharge will be found. The language of this section is explicit, and leaves but little for construction. The application must specify the particular act or acts upon which the creditor intends to rely, and the inquiry is to be limited to the acts thus specified. " No evidence shall be admitted as to any other acts." Under the insolvent laws of the States, it had been held, that acts not set out in the specification might, for certain purposes, be put in evidence. The clause quoted would exclude such evidence. The act is to be clearly and distinctly stated, so that the, bankrupt may be prepared to answer it. Application to specify grounds of avoidance. If fraud is relied on, the creditor must give the particular aets which constitute the fraud. Dresser v. Brooks, 3 Barb. 429; Kemp v. Neville, 5 Moore, 21; Lathrop v. Stewart, 6 McLean, 630. If concealment is relied on, the manner of the concealment must be stated, and the stage of the proceedings in which it occurred. Brereton v. Hull, 1 Denio, 75. See Rand v. Upham, 2 Fest. (N. H.) 39. The specification may be amended. It has been held, that a specification might be amended under the statutes of the State, permitting amendments of pleadings. Stewart v. Hargrove, 23 Ala. 429. (d) The hearing under this clause is undoubtedly to be had before the court. There seems to be no provision for a trial by jury. If the facts specified are proved, and if the court is satisfied they were not known to the contesting creditor before the discharge was granted, the discharge shall be set aside and annulled.
